The Autumn Records Story

Gene Sculatti, Edsel Records, 1986

It was no Sun Records. It wasn't Philles or Dimension, or Cameo-Parkway or even Big Top. But Autumn Records surely qualifies as one of America's most curious and colorful independent labels – for the handful of great sides it issued, for the promise of what it almost became, and for the fact that it so boldly and swingingly occupied the right place at the right time.
